Five people, including three children, were hospitalized after a stabbing near a school in Dublin’s Parnell Square on Thursday afternoon. Despite the investigation being still in its “early stages,” Irish police confirmed that there is “no terror-related activity” and that the stabbing “appear(ed) to be a standalone attack.”
